kernel-packages team mailing list archive

[Bug 1387886] Re: Trusty update to v3.13.11.10 stable release


** Branch linked: lp:ubuntu/precise-proposed/linux-lts-trusty

You received this bug notification because you are a member of Kernel
Packages, which is subscribed to linux in Ubuntu.

  Trusty update to v3.13.11.10 stable release

Status in “linux” package in Ubuntu:
Status in “linux” source package in Trusty:
  Fix Committed

Bug description:
  SRU Justification

         The upstream process for stable tree updates is quite similar
         in scope to the Ubuntu SRU process, e.g., each patch has to
         demonstrably fix a bug, and each patch is vetted by upstream
         by originating either directly from Linus' tree or in a minimally
         backported form of that patch. The v3.13.11.10 upstream stable
         patch set is now available. It should be included in the Ubuntu
         kernel as well.



         The following patches are in the v3.13.11.10 stable release:

  Bluetooth: Fix HCI H5 corrupted ack value
  dmaengine: fix xor sources continuation
  siano: add support for PCTV 77e
  em28xx-v4l: give back all active video buffers to the vb2 core properly on streaming stop
  em28xx-v4l: fix video buffer field order reporting in progressive mode
  crypto: caam - fix addressing of struct member
  x86, fpu: shift drop_init_fpu() from save_xstate_sig() to handle_signal()
  x86, fpu: __restore_xstate_sig()->math_state_restore() needs preempt_disable()
  KVM: do not bias the generation number in kvm_current_mmio_generation
  kvm: fix potentially corrupt mmio cache
  kvm: x86: fix stale mmio cache bug
  UBIFS: fix free log space calculation
  Bluetooth: Fix issue with USB suspend in btusb driver
  mmc: rtsx_pci_sdmmc: fix incorrect last byte in R2 response
  KVM: s390: unintended fallthrough for external call
  UBI: add missing kmem_cache_free() in process_pool_aeb error path
  PCI: Increase IBM ipr SAS Crocodile BARs to at least system page size
  drbd: compute the end before rb_insert_augmented()
  Bluetooth: Fix setting correct security level when initiating SMP
  mmc: tmio: prevent endless loop in tmio_mmc_set_clock()
  iwlwifi: Add missing PCI IDs for the 7260 series
  media: usb: uvc: add a quirk for Dell XPS M1330 webcam
  Revert "percpu: free percpu allocation info for uniprocessor system"
  USB: serial: cp210x: added Ketra N1 wireless interface support
  USB: cp210x: add support for Seluxit USB dongle
  PCI: Generate uppercase hex for modalias interface class
  PCI: mvebu: Fix uninitialized variable in mvebu_get_tgt_attr()
  xfs: ensure WB_SYNC_ALL writeback handles partial pages correctly
  v4l2-common: fix overflow in v4l_bound_align_image()
  USB: Add device quirk for ASUS T100 Base Station keyboard
  mei: bus: fix possible boundaries violation
  firmware_class: make sure fw requests contain a name
  Drivers: hv: vmbus: Cleanup vmbus_post_msg()
  Drivers: hv: vmbus: Cleanup vmbus_teardown_gpadl()
  Drivers: hv: vmbus: Cleanup vmbus_establish_gpadl()
  Drivers: hv: vmbus: Fix a bug in vmbus_open()
  Drivers: hv: vmbus: Cleanup vmbus_close_internal()
  Drivers: hv: vmbus: Cleanup hv_post_message()
  spi: dw-mid: respect 8 bit mode
  spi: dw-mid: terminate ongoing transfers at exit
  kvm: don't take vcpu mutex for obviously invalid vcpu ioctls
  x86/intel/quark: Switch off CR4.PGE so TLB flush uses CR3 instead
  ARM: at91: fix at91sam9263ek DT mmc pinmuxing settings
  ARM: at91/PMC: don't forget to write PMC_PCDR register to disable clocks
  Fixing lease renewal
  lockd: Try to reconnect if statd has moved
  qla2xxx: Use correct offset to req-q-out for reserve calculation
  power: charger-manager: Fix NULL pointer exception with missing cm-fuel-gauge
  rt2800: correct BBP1_TX_POWER_CTRL mask
  regmap: fix NULL pointer dereference in _regmap_write/read
  Documentation: lzo: document part of the encoding
  Revert "lzo: properly check for overruns"
  lzo: check for length overrun in variable length encoding.
  regmap: debugfs: fix possbile NULL pointer dereference
  regmap: fix possible ZERO_SIZE_PTR pointer dereferencing error.
  net_dma: simple removal
  libata-sff: Fix controllers with no ctl port
  NFSv4: Fix lock recovery when CREATE_SESSION/SETCLIENTID_CONFIRM fails
  NFSv4: fix open/lock state recovery error handling
  tty: omap-serial: fix division by zero
  serial: 8250: Add Quark X1000 to 8250_pci.c
  missing data dependency barrier in prepend_name()
  be2iscsi: check ip buffer before copying
  framebuffer: fix border color
  framebuffer: fix screen corruption when copying
  mpc85xx_edac: Make L2 interrupt shared too
  NFSv4.1: Fix an NFSv4.1 state renewal regression
  xen-blkback: fix leak on grant map error path
  m68k: Disable/restore interrupts in hwreg_present()/hwreg_write()
  ASoC: tlv320aic3x: fix PLL D configuration
  dm bufio: update last_accessed when relinking a buffer
  dm bufio: when done scanning return from __scan immediately
  dm log userspace: fix memory leak in dm_ulog_tfr_init failure path
  ecryptfs: avoid to access NULL pointer when write metadata in xattr
  x86_64, entry: Filter RFLAGS.NT on entry from userspace
  ASoC: soc-dapm: fix use after free
  pata_serverworks: disable 64-KB DMA transfers on Broadcom OSB4 IDE Controller
  drm/ast: Fix HW cursor image
  x86: Reject x32 executables if x32 ABI not supported
  kill wbuf_queued/wbuf_dwork_lock
  fs: Fix theoretical division by 0 in super_cache_scan().
  fs: make cont_expand_zero interruptible
  fix misuses of f_count() in ppp and netlink
  block: fix alignment_offset math that assumes io_min is a power-of-2
  fanotify: enable close-on-exec on events' fd when requested in fanotify_init()
  mm: clear __GFP_FS when PF_MEMALLOC_NOIO is set
  Input: i8042 - add noloop quirk for Asus X750LN
  um: ubd: Fix for processes stuck in D state forever
  kernel: add support for gcc 5
  ALSA: emu10k1: Fix deadlock in synth voice lookup
  libceph: ceph-msgr workqueue needs a resque worker
  mnt: Prevent pivot_root from creating a loop in the mount tree
  modules, lock around setting of MODULE_STATE_UNFORMED
  virtio_pci: fix virtio spec compliance on restore
  selinux: fix inode security list corruption
  pstore: Fix duplicate {console,ftrace}-efi entries
  futex: Ensure get_futex_key_refs() always implies a barrier
  x86,kvm,vmx: Preserve CR4 across VM entry
  crypto: caam - remove duplicated sg copy functions

